The right and left ventricle myocardium of rats was studied in the course of a 12-month period of adaptation to high altitude (3200 m above the sea level). A long-term exposure of the animals to the high altitude led the development of ventricular hypertrophy mostly of the right, and partly of the left ventricle. Hyperplasia and hypertrophy of individual organellae, particularly mitochondria, were found in most cardiomyocytes of both ventricles. In animals adapted to the high altitude the mitochondrial succinic dehydrogenase activity was more pronounced than in control ones. The results obtained testified to the enhanced intracellular metabolism reflecting myocardial compensatory adaptive responses.
